Where Are You Going, Adhiban?

Maria Emelianova’s photo spread from the European Team Championship in Crete


The European Team Championship started in Creta Maris Beach Resort Hotel with official speeches and anthems. The ECU presented its new hymn.

 

Chief Arbiter Panagiotis Nikolopoulos celebrated his 60th anniversary on November 1.  

 

As usually, the Opening Ceremony didn’t go without national dances…

 

...and drawing of lots. Alexander Grischuk drew White in the open section.

 

...Alexandra Kosteniuk decided that she deserved to play with white pieces as well.

 

Both events are being played in a spacious Conference Hall of the hotel.  

 

One of the central matches in the women's section: Georgia vs. Russia.  

 

After a successful start the Russian men's team suffered a bitter loss from Hungary.

 

Valentina Gunina brought important points to her team in rounds 3 and 4.

 

Olga Girya deserved a free day in round 5.

 

The captain of the Russian women's team Sergei Rublevsky never leaves the playing hall. A book helps him cope with tension.  

 

Daniil Dubov solidly covers the team’s back.

 

Levon Aronian didn't leave his team without a permanent leader even after winning the World Cup and getting married.

 

An unexpected guest at the ETCC. Baskaran Adhiban says that he answers a question: «What are you doing here?» 10 times a day. It has emerged that he had come to Crete to help the Georgian women’s team.

 

The Georgian team did well before the match with Russia. Elizbar Ubilava and Sergei Rublevsky analysing.
